Introduction: The Importance of Sporting Lisbon
Sporting Lisbon, officially known as Sporting Clube de Portugal, is one of the most iconic football clubs in Portugal. Established in 1906, the club has made substantial contributions to the sport, notably through its youth academy that has produced numerous professional players. Sporting Lisbon’s role in the football landscape not only represents a rich tradition but also reflects the cultural heritage of Portuguese football.
History and Achievements
Sporting Lisbon, based in Lisbon, has enjoyed considerable success in both domestic and international competitions. The club has secured the Primeira Liga title over 20 times, showcasing its supremacy in national tournaments. Additionally, Sporting has claimed numerous Taca de Portugal titles, contributing to its reputation as a football powerhouse in Portugal.
Internationally, Sporting Lisbon achieved significant recognition by winning the UEFA Cup Winners’ Cup in 1964. This victory solidified the club’s presence in European football. The club’s achievements are complemented by their famous green and white striped jerseys, a symbol of pride for fans known as ‘Leões’ or Lions.
The Youth Academy: A Hotbed for Talent
One of the standout features of Sporting Lisbon is its academy, which has been instrumental in developing talents such as Cristiano Ronaldo, Luís Figo, and Nani. The academy is renowned for its commitment to nurturing young players, making it a significant contributor to the club’s long-term success. The focus on youth development ensures that Sporting continues to challenge for titles and maintain a competitive edge in the Portuguese league.
